TokenPocket to Rabby: Switching Mobile Wallets While Keeping Your Assets Safe and Accessible

0

A user managing cryptocurrency across multiple chains has used TokenPocket for months, accumulating positions, creating transaction history, and building familiarity with its interface. But wallet preferences shift. Some users migrate toward desktop or browser-based management. Others seek different security models, feature sets, or integration options. The question is not whether to switch—it is how to move without creating confusion, loss, or unnecessary exposure of recovery information.

Rabby Wallet occupies a different space in the ecosystem. It operates as a browser extension rather than a mobile app, which changes how users interact with dApps, sign transactions, and manage multiple accounts. Yet the underlying asset custody remains unchanged. Your private keys, seed phrases, and account relationships do not transfer between wallets the way a file moves between folders. Instead, migration requires understanding which recovery methods are compatible, how to verify that your assets remain accessible at the same addresses, and when hardware wallet or WalletConnect connections offer a safer path than exporting sensitive information.

Why the wallet changes, but the blockchain addresses stay the same

A critical misconception in wallet switching is the assumption that changing applications means changing where your cryptocurrency lives. It does not. An Ethereum address, Solana public key, or Bitcoin wallet derived from a seed phrase remains at that same location on the blockchain regardless of which software interface you use to view or control it. The blockchain itself does not know or care which application you opened this morning. It knows only whether a transaction is properly signed by the corresponding private key.

This distinction matters because it shapes the migration strategy. You are not moving assets from TokenPocket to Rabby the way you might move files from one folder to another. Instead, you are instructing a new interface to recognize and control the same addresses that TokenPocket already manages. The asset balance exists on the blockchain. The wallet is the tool for viewing and spending it.

Understanding this prevents a common panic: a user imports their seed phrase into Rabby, sees no balance initially, and assumes the funds have vanished. In reality, the import process worked correctly. The funds are still at the address. The wallet is simply displaying it. A brief delay in synchronization or the need to manually add a token to the watch list can look like loss if the mental model is wrong. The correct verification is to take an address from Rabby, paste it into a block explorer, and confirm that the balance shown on-chain matches the wallet display.

Direct seed phrase import: the most straightforward path with clear risks

If you have your TokenPocket recovery phrase, importing it directly into Rabby is the fastest way to regain access to your accounts. The process is mechanical: open Rabby Wallet app, select “import existing wallet,” choose the number of words in your recovery phrase (12, 15, 24), enter them in order, and confirm. Rabby will derive the same addresses that TokenPocket displayed, provided both wallets use the same derivation path—a technical detail that is usually correct but worth verifying for accounts using non-standard paths.

The risk is straightforward: your recovery phrase is now stored in two different applications on potentially different devices. If either application is compromised, malicious software could access the phrase. If either device is stolen, an attacker with physical access could extract the phrase. The phrase is also no longer secured only by the device where it was originally written down; it now depends on the security of Rabby’s storage mechanism, the browser extension sandbox, and your operating system.

The mitigation is proportional to the amount at stake. For a portfolio worth several hundred dollars, the added risk may be acceptable if your devices are well-maintained and you trust the applications. For accounts controlling substantially larger balances, the direct import path should be temporary—a way to regain access while you set up a more durable arrangement. That arrangement might be a hardware wallet, a watch-only setup with signing delegated elsewhere, or a deliberate decision to use Rabby only for small amounts while keeping major balances under different controls.

Before importing, verify that you have written down the recovery phrase in a safe location. A phrase that exists only in memory is a phrase that vanishes if you forget it or if the device is lost. A phrase written in a notes app on the same device as the wallet defeats the purpose of having a backup. A phrase photographed, emailed, or stored in cloud services is exposed to compromise. The safe standards remain: write it on paper, store it in a fireproof safe, and ensure at least one other trusted person knows where it is.

Private key import for targeted account access

Some users have extracted private keys from TokenPocket—perhaps a single account or a testing address—and prefer to import only that key rather than the entire seed phrase. Rabby supports private key import, which allows you to control a specific account without exposing the master seed. This is useful if you want to move only one or two accounts while keeping the TokenPocket seed isolated elsewhere.

The same security logic applies with one modification: a private key associated with a single account is less catastrophic if leaked than a seed phrase that generates all accounts. However, importing a private key still means that the key now exists in two places—TokenPocket and Rabby. If either is compromised, the account is at risk. The account’s transaction history is not compromised, because that is stored on the blockchain. But future transactions can be intercepted, and funds can be stolen.

A practical use case is importing a single private key into Rabby temporarily to move funds to an address controlled by hardware or a more secure setup, then deleting the key from Rabby afterward. This converts the private key from a permanent storage location to a temporary signing tool. Once the funds are gone, there is no longer a balance to steal, and the exposure window is closed.

WalletConnect: keeping TokenPocket as your signer while using Rabby as an interface

If you want to access your TokenPocket accounts through Rabby without importing any sensitive information, WalletConnect provides a bridge. Rabby can connect to TokenPocket Mobile through a QR code scan. Once connected, you can view balances and prepare transactions in Rabby, but the actual signing happens in TokenPocket on your mobile device. This keeps the private keys in one place—TokenPocket—while giving you desktop access through Rabby.

The workflow is straightforward. In Rabby, select “connect WalletConnect,” scan the QR code displayed in TokenPocket’s WalletConnect menu, and authorize the connection. After that, Rabby will show your TokenPocket accounts, and you can initiate transactions. When you sign, Rabby will prompt you to switch to TokenPocket on your phone, where you confirm and sign the transaction. The signed transaction then returns to Rabby for broadcast to the network.

This arrangement offers several advantages. Your recovery phrase never leaves TokenPocket. Your private keys remain on your mobile device rather than your computer. The connection is session-based, meaning you can disconnect WalletConnect after you are done, and future transactions would require you to reconnect or sign through TokenPocket directly. The tradeoff is convenience: signing every transaction requires touching your phone, which is slower than having all keys available locally but materially more secure for meaningful balances.

WalletConnect is also less permanent than importing a seed phrase. If Rabby is compromised, the attacker can see your account balances and transaction history, but cannot sign transactions or move funds without access to your phone. That is a substantial difference from direct import, where compromise of Rabby means compromise of the accounts themselves.

Hardware wallet integration: the most durable path

Both Rabby and TokenPocket support hardware wallets, but the integration differs slightly. If you have a Ledger, Trezor, GridPlus, OneKey, Keystone, BitBox02, CoolWallet, or AirGap Vault device, Rabby can connect directly using USB (on desktop) or Bluetooth (on some devices). This means your private keys remain on the hardware device at all times. Rabby becomes a transaction manager and viewer, but not a key holder.

Migrating via hardware wallet requires no import of sensitive information. You connect the hardware device to Rabby through the appropriate protocol, authorize the connection, and Rabby displays the accounts it derives from the device. If you want to move away from TokenPocket entirely, you simply stop using TokenPocket and use Rabby exclusively. Your accounts do not change, because they are defined by the hardware device, not by either software wallet.

This approach is most durable because your key material never exists on an internet-connected device. The hardware device generates transactions, signs them, and returns only the signature to Rabby for broadcast. Even if Rabby is completely compromised, the funds cannot be moved without physical access to the hardware device and knowledge of its PIN. For users with substantial balances or long-term holdings, this is the path that reduces risk the most.

The initial setup is slightly more involved than direct import. You connect the hardware device, authorize Rabby to use it, and then confirm that the accounts Rabby displays match the accounts you expected. Most hardware wallets derive accounts from a standard path, so this verification is usually trivial. But it is worth doing: take one account address from Rabby, paste it into a block explorer, and confirm that the blockchain shows the balance you expect.

Mobile wallet connection: using MetaMask, Trust Wallet, or other apps with Rabby

Rabby also supports connections to other mobile wallet applications, not just TokenPocket. If your cryptocurrency is managed through MetaMask Mobile, Trust Wallet, Bitget Wallet, imToken, Math Wallet, or other apps that support WalletConnect, you can connect them to Rabby using the same bridge protocol. This provides flexibility: you keep your primary management app on mobile, but gain a desktop interface without importing keys.

The connection works identically to the TokenPocket WalletConnect scenario. Scan a QR code, authorize the connection, and then use Rabby to view and prepare transactions. Signing happens in the mobile app. This is particularly useful if you have accounts in multiple mobile wallets and want a consolidated view in Rabby without consolidating your key storage.

One consideration is that each WalletConnect session is a separate permission. If you connect TokenPocket, MetaMask Mobile, and Trust Wallet all to Rabby, each can be disconnected independently. A compromised Rabby installation can see all connected accounts, but cannot sign with any of them. The security boundary is the mobile device where your keys actually live. Rabby is the interface, not the vault.

Watch-only accounts and verification

If you want to monitor an address or portfolio without the ability to sign transactions, Rabby supports watch-only mode. You can enter any public address—an address derived from TokenPocket that you want to observe, or any other address you control elsewhere—and Rabby will display the balance and transaction history. This is useful for portfolio tracking or monitoring accounts that you intentionally keep inaccessible from your current setup.

Watch-only accounts cannot sign transactions or approve token permissions, which makes them safe even if Rabby is compromised. The tradeoff is obvious: you cannot spend the funds. This is appropriate for cold storage addresses that you rarely touch, or for accounts you want to monitor without immediate spending access.

Before treating any Rabby display as authoritative, verify it against a block explorer. The public address is what matters; Rabby’s display of the balance is convenient but not the ground truth. Open a block explorer such as Etherscan (for Ethereum), Solscan (for Solana), or the appropriate chain explorer, paste the address, and confirm that the balance shown on-chain matches what Rabby reports. This verification takes one minute and ensures that you are not relying on a corrupted or misconfigured wallet application.

Institutional and contact management features

Rabby also supports connections to institutional wallets including Safe, Cobo, Argus, Amber, Fireblocks, and others. If you manage accounts through a multi-signature safe or an institutional custody solution, Rabby can connect to those accounts through the appropriate integration. The same principles apply: Rabby is the interface, the institutional solution is the vault. Signing still requires authorization from the institution’s signing infrastructure.

Contact management is a secondary feature that can streamline transactions. Rather than pasting an Ethereum address every time you send funds to the same recipient, you can save the address with a name and label. This reduces copy-paste errors, which are a common source of funds being sent to the wrong address. The contact is stored locally in Rabby, not synced to a server, which preserves privacy while adding convenience.

Practical migration checklist: from TokenPocket to Rabby

Before migrating, follow this sequence. First, write down or locate your TokenPocket recovery phrase and verify it is stored safely offline. Do not skip this; a recovery phrase is a backup, and a backup is useless if you do not know where it is or if it was never written down.

Second, decide on your security model. Will you use hardware wallet connection (most secure, requires a device), WalletConnect to TokenPocket (good security, requires your phone), or direct seed phrase import (convenient, requires careful device security)? This decision should depend on the amount at stake and your risk tolerance.

Third, if using hardware wallet, connect it to Rabby and verify that it displays the expected accounts and balances. If using WalletConnect, scan the QR code from TokenPocket. If importing the seed phrase, enter it carefully and verify that the first account matches what you expect.

Fourth, verify a single account address in a block explorer to confirm that Rabby is showing the correct balance. Do not assume that the display is correct without this check.

Fifth, perform a test transaction. Send a small amount (perhaps $10–50 worth) from your TokenPocket account to a new address in Rabby, or vice versa. Confirm that the transaction goes through and the funds arrive. This proves that your setup is working before you move larger amounts.

Sixth, once you are confident that Rabby is working correctly and you have multiple ways to access your accounts, you can reduce your dependence on TokenPocket. You do not need to delete TokenPocket immediately; having multiple wallet applications that can access the same accounts is actually a backup strategy. But you can move your daily interaction to Rabby.

Throughout this process, never share your recovery phrase with anyone, never enter it into a website or app that you did not install yourself from an official source, and never give someone remote access to your device if they ask to “help” with wallet setup. Those scenarios are where assets are actually stolen.

Frequently asked questions

If I import my TokenPocket recovery phrase into Rabby, do my cryptocurrency assets move?

No. Your assets remain on the blockchain at the same addresses. Importing the recovery phrase into Rabby simply allows Rabby to recognize and control those same addresses. The blockchain does not know or care which wallet application you use. Both TokenPocket and Rabby will display the same balance if they are working correctly, because they are accessing the same addresses on the same blockchain.

Is it safer to use WalletConnect from TokenPocket to Rabby, or to import my recovery phrase directly?

WalletConnect is safer because your recovery phrase and private keys remain in TokenPocket on your mobile device. Rabby acts as an interface only; signing requires your phone. Direct import means your keys are now stored in two places—TokenPocket and Rabby—which doubles the exposure risk. For larger balances, WalletConnect or hardware wallet connection are preferable. For testing amounts, direct import is acceptable if your devices are secure.

Can I use Rabby with a hardware wallet like Ledger instead of importing my recovery phrase?

Yes. Rabby supports direct connection to Ledger, Trezor, GridPlus, OneKey, Keystone, BitBox02, CoolWallet, and AirGap Vault. Connect the hardware wallet to Rabby via USB or Bluetooth, and your accounts will appear without importing any key material. This is the most durable arrangement because your keys never leave the hardware device, and Rabby cannot be compromised in a way that exposes them.
